Ian Tizard

Ian R. Tizard · Ian R. Tizard PhD BSc BVMS · Ina Tjardes · Iona Teeguarden

titleISBN-13
(ISBN-10)
year of publication
IMMUNOLOGY 3E978-0-03-033362-0
(0-03-033362-8)
1992
Immunology: An Introduction978-0-03-004198-3
(0-03-004198-8)
1994

Ian Todd